Booking Your Commission

To book your commission, please contact me via this website or Facebook messenger. You will need to disclose your requirements, supply high quality reference photos, and pay the deposit. 

 

Due to high business volume, commissions are typically booked months in advance. Portraits are completed in the order they are received. If you need a portrait to be completed by a specific deadline (for example someone's birthday), please notify me of the preferred finish date when you initially contact me. I will do everything I can to accommodate the time frame, however cannot make any guarantees if I have other bookings scheduled before yours.

​

 I will not book your commission until a deposit has been received.

 

I will first send you a rough concept used from your reference photo for final approval before I begin on the actual piece. I will also keep you posted with pictures as the piece progresses, if you prefer.  Once the piece has been started, it will usually take 5 to 8 weeks to be completed.

Photo References

In order to create a realistic, vibrant portrait that's full of life and character, your photos absolutely need to be of a high resolution,  in focus, and clearly show your pet's entire head.  The more detailed the reference photo is, the more detailed your commission piece will be. This is especially crucial when it comes to your pet's eyes. They need to be clearly portrayed, as the colors and light interaction are what create expression and uniqueness.  

 

If you're taking the photos yourself, please take them outside in natural light, preferably a cloudy day. Bright sunshine and artificial light result in harsh and overdrawn shadows.  Please also take the photos at your pet's height. If the photo is taken while you're standing above or below your pet, it can create an unflattering or distorted view.  You can hold your pets' favorite treat or toy to the side or slightly above the camera to direct their full attention towards the lens.

 

If you supply photographs that came from a professional photographer, please provide me with written permission from them that comply with copyright laws.  

​

If you do not have high quality photographs, I may not be able complete a commission for you.  I cannot go off of photos that are of low resolution, poor lighting, or poor angles. Please remember, you have seen your pet every day and therefore know the little details that make them unique. In most cases, I have not seen your pet in person, just the photographs your provide me. So I cannot simply "fill in or imagine" the details that are missing from your photos. That would risk me creating details that were never present in your pet.
